Do you need a microphone shock mount?
Do I really need a shock mount? Using a shock mount is always recommended. There is nothing worse than ruining your magic take and it is always better to play it safe. Especially when your microphone is placed on a table and when you move a lot in the area of your microphone, a shock mount is important to have.

Why can I only hear my mic in one ear?
This issue is usually caused by recording a mono source (one mic or one guitar) onto a stereo audio track. In some DAWs, you can select the Input to be mono when you add a new track, whereas in other DAWs, you need to set the Input to be mono after adding the track.
What is phantom power on an amplifier?
Phantom Power is a term given to the process of delivering DC (Direct Current) to microphones requiring electric power to drive active circuitry. Condenser microphones such as Shure’s KSM range all have active circuitry and require phantom power.
How important is shock mount?
Is it essential to use a shock mount with a microphone when recording? It is not always essential, but it does reduce the intensity of unwanted low frequency vibrations passing from the floor, through the mic stand and into the microphone.
How do I mute my ATR2500 Audio Technica?
You have to go to the bottom right hand corner of your PC and right click on the speakers icon. Then click recording devices. Locate the ATR2500 microphone and right click. Then click disable this device.
